Suggest Remedies For Jaw Pain Post Lower Molar Tooth Removal

Do you know anything about jaw pain? I had a lower molar extracted 8 days ago. The extraction site feels okay but I am having horrendous pain in my upperand lower jaw. The pain is intermident but severe. I am on antibiotics and pain medication without relief .

Dentist 's  Response
Hello & Welcome,
Thanks for sharing your concern,

Please visit your dentist for clinical evaluation. There might be clot dislodgement & dry socket.

It requires irrigation & analgesic dressing.

Mere pain killer wont help.

Meanwhile do warm saline rinses.
